Bharatiya Janata Party (BJP) National President Amit Shah would once again visit Chhattisgarh during the last week of September.
During his visit, Shah would chair BJP’s crucial Core Group Meeting where discussions would be held to finalize the candidates for the upcoming assembly polls. BJP sources informed that the BJP Chief would be on a visit of the state on September 29. During his visit, Shah would also address a meeting of Shakti Kendra where a gathering of 25,000 people is expected.
He would also motivate and energize the Shakti Kendras and will guide them on the duties to be performed for the upcoming elections.
During his visit, Shah would also inaugurate an auditorium at State BJP office Ekatma Parisar, sources informed.
